Celebrated Inuit Graphic Artist Kenojuak Ashevak Enthralled with Nature-Inspired Art
Kenojuak Ashevak, one of Canada's most distinguished graphic artists, was an exemplary member of the Inuit community. Born in an igloo in an Arctic village, Ashevak spent her life surrounded by the natural beauty that inspired her vivid and stylistic artwork.
Recognized for her depictions of animals, particularly birds, Ashevak's art showcased a unique blend of tradition and innovation. Her pieces, often characterized by vibrant colors and intricate detail, became highly sought-after and eventually garnered her global acclaim.
The owl was a recurring source of inspiration for Ashevak, who produced over 100 unique owl prints. Theseprints, adorned with captivating titles, showcased a stunning array of colors and intricate patterns.
This owl art project seeks to inspire the next generation of artists by emulating the Preening Owl print, one of Ashevak's most famous works. To create your own masterpiece, follow the steps below using the free printable owl template provided:
Owl Art Project
Materials Needed:
- Owl printable template
- Colored paper
- Scissors
- Glue stick
- Toothpick
- White paint
Instructions:
- Print the owl template and cut it out.
- Cut pieces from colored paper using the template as a guide.
- Glue the owl body onto a large piece of colored paper.
- Use white paint and a toothpick to create polka dots on the owl's body.
- Attach the owl's face to the body.
- Glue the remaining owl pieces around the painted body.
